What is Glasp?

Glasp is a free AI-powered online highlighter and note-taking tool built for readers, researchers, and lifelong learners. It allows users to highlight text from articles, YouTube videos, and PDFs directly in the browser, while saving those highlights to a personal knowledge base. Glasp also creates a social layer for learning—users can follow others, discover public notes, and collaborate on shared topics. It’s a lightweight tool that simplifies online reading, retention, and content discovery.

Key Features

  • Web Page Highlighting
    Highlight text directly from blogs, articles, PDFs, or eBooks in your browser using the Glasp extension.
  • YouTube Video Highlighting
    Capture quotes, summaries, and timestamps from YouTube videos and turn them into text-based highlights.
  • Personal Knowledge Base
    Organize highlights and notes by tags, topics, and categories for easy reference later.
  • AI Summary Generation
    Automatically summarize web content or notes using Glasp’s built-in AI assistant.
  • Social Learning Feed
    View and follow other users’ public highlights to discover insights on topics you care about.
  • Export & Integration
    Export highlights to Notion, Readwise, Obsidian, or Markdown for deeper note-taking workflows.
  • Collaborative Highlighting
    Share and collaborate on reading lists or topics with teams or study groups.
  • Daily & Weekly Review
    Automated review of your saved highlights to reinforce learning and long-term memory.

Pros

  • Great for readers and knowledge workers
  • Lightweight and easy to use in the browser
  • Works with articles, videos, and PDFs
  • Promotes social and collaborative learning
  • Free to use with generous core features

Cons

  • No full offline mode
  • Limited advanced formatting or writing tools
  • Still growing its user base and ecosystem
  • Not designed for long-form writing
  • Highlight syncing requires extension/browser access

Pricing Model

  • Free Plan: Unlimited highlights, AI summaries, video support, and social features
  • Premium Plan: Coming soon – Will include advanced AI features, extended integrations, and enhanced review tools
    (As of now, Glasp is primarily free and developing its paid offerings)
